โฆ Synopsis
Introduces recent research results of finite difference methods including important nonlinear evolution equations in applied science. The presented difference schemes include nonlinear difference schemes and linearized difference schemes. Features widely used nonlinear evolution equations such as Burgers equation, regular long wave equation, Schrodinger equation and more. Each PDE model includes details on efficiency, stability, and convergence.
